## CSV Import Wizard — Approval Requirements

All releases of the Fernhollow CSV Import Wizard require two approvals before the release manager can tag a build: one from QA covering the delimiter-detection suite, and one from the data-integrity reviewer covering header mapping and rollback behavior. Hotfixes follow the same process; there is no expedited path. Approval records must be attached to the release checklist before cutover. The accountable approver of record is listed below.

named custodian: Brivan Eliath Quenox Frador

## Deploying the Gatewick Proctor Queue

Deploys are pretty painless: push to main, wait for the pipeline, then watch the queue drain dashboard for five minutes. If candidates pile up mid-exam, roll back first and ask questions later — the queue replays safely. Everything the workers care about lives in one config block, shown here for reference.

settings of bafof-yagef:
JOROX_PIN=8740
JOROX_TENANT=pelox
JOROX_METRICS_HOST=metrics.jorox.qorvelworks.internal
JOROX_SEAL=seal_c78f63c1
JOROX_STANDBY_TEAM=norax

This release reduces the Pellwick service base image from 1.4 GB to 310 MB. We moved to a multi-stage build, dropped the debug toolchain from the runtime layer, and switched to the minimal Thornlight base. New contractors should note: shell utilities are no longer present in production containers, so use the sidecar debug image for troubleshooting. Build times dropped roughly 40%. Nothing about application behavior changed, but please verify your local builds. Direct any build-pipeline questions to the maintainer below.

account owner for bawip-tahag: Raleth Quenok

Ticket #: vault lockout — Restocka planner

The credentials vault holding the Restocka vending-machine restock planner's scheduling secrets locked after three failed unlock attempts this morning. Per the escrow procedure, support staff should restore access using the sealed recovery material and then rotate all stored secrets within 24 hours. To unseal, enter the recovery passphrase exactly as written below.

unlock words, hahip-yagef: zorok-novmir-zorix-silax